Summary

The Project Manager will lead cross-functional initiatives within a research-driven environment, ensuring timely delivery of strategic projects that enhance operational performance. This role emphasizes structured project execution, stakeholder engagement, and robust change management to support Biomedical Research (BR) goals. The Project Manager will collaborate with scientific and operational teams to drive alignment, transparency, and measurable impact across BR, while fostering a culture of adaptability and continuous improvement.

About the Role

Key Responsibilities :

Lead and manage complex projects from initiation through execution and closure, ensuring alignment with strategic objectives and timely delivery.

Develop detailed project plans, timelines, and resource allocations, and monitor progress against milestones.

Facilitate cross-functional collaboration, ensuring effective communication and coordination among scientific, operational, and support teams.

Apply structured change management methodologies to guide teams through transitions, ensuring stakeholder engagement, adoption, and sustainability of new processes or systems.

Identify risks and develop mitigation strategies to ensure project success.

Prepare and present project updates, dashboards, and reports to senior leadership and stakeholders.

Promote a culture of accountability, transparency, and continuous improvement across project teams.

Maintain comprehensive project documentation including charters, plans, meeting minutes, and lessons learned.

Build and maintain strong relationships with internal and external partners to ensure alignment and support.

Serve as a change agent by coaching teams through organizational shifts and fostering resilience in dynamic environments.

Essential Requirements :

Bachelor's degree in life sciences, engineering, business discipline or related field

Minimum of 5 years of experience in project management,

Proven track record of successfully managing cross-functional projects in a matrixed organization.

Strong knowledge of project management methodologies and tools.

Demonstrated experience in change management, including stakeholder analysis, communication planning, and implementation support.

Excellent organizational, analytical, and problem-solving skills.

Proficiency in project management software (e.g., MS Project, JIRA).

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to influence and collaborate across all levels.

Demonstrated proficiency in leveraging AI-powered productivity tools (e.g., Microsoft Copilot, ChatGPT, or similar) to enhance project planning, data analysis, documentation, and stakeholder communication.

Desirable Requirements :

Experience in a research or drug discovery environment.

PMP or equivalent certification is highly desirable; certification in change management (e.g., Prosci, ACMP) is a plus.

Experience working across multiple sites or in international settings

The salary for this position is expected to range between $114,100 and $211,900 per year.

The final salary offered is determined based on factors like, but not limited to, relevant skills and experience, and upon joining Novartis will be reviewed periodically. Novartis may change the published salary range based on company and market factors.

Your compensation will include a performance-based cash incentive and, depending on the level of the role, eligibility to be considered for annual equity awards.

US-based eligible employees will receive a comprehensive benefits package that includes health, life and disability benefits, a 401(k) with company contribution and match, and a variety of other benefits. In addition, employees are eligible for a generous time off package including vacation, personal days, holidays and other leaves.
